The Village of Sheen in the County of Staffordshire

Advertisement

The village of Sheen is located within the county of Staffordshire.

Sheen is situated in the West Midlands (England) region of the UK and is governed by Staffordshire Moorlands, council.

The village of Sheen is in the Staffordshire CC region of Shropshire and Staffordshire within West Midlands (England).

Advertisement
  • Staffordshire Moorlands

Where is Sheen is located in the UK

Share the Love - How would you describe Sheen?

Map of the village of Sheen in Staffordshire

No data to display